Output 3a33bd46c21c5f0cf43e707e0d8b84047b50eaba0c6635face16ab4dedb960ea:0

value
1444805
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85f68407a3a2757ef55e6dcb7d87098259d8ff58 OP_EQUAL
address
3DuM7GgaHfbDNvLNsZt2C5mWLvkjJWn9G5
transaction
3a33bd46c21c5f0cf43e707e0d8b84047b50eaba0c6635face16ab4dedb960ea
confirmations
465549
spent
true